西工大软件学院复试真题 csdn
时间: 2023-09-19 19:04:10 浏览: 203
CSDN是一个广受软件从业者喜爱的技术社区,而西工大软件学院的复试题目则是指该学院在招生过程中对申请者进行的面试环节中所提出的问题。以下是对西工大软件学院复试真题以及与CSDN之间的相关性的回答。
西工大软件学院的复试真题主要是针对软件开发相关知识和能力的考察,目的是评估申请者是否具备深入学习和研究软件相关领域的潜力。这些题目通常包括编程语言、数据结构与算法、数据库、操作系统、网络等方面的内容。例如,可能会考察申请者的编程能力,要求编写一个特定功能的程序,并分析其时间复杂度和空间复杂度。
CSDN作为一个技术社区,提供了大量的软件开发相关资源和交流平台。它汇聚了许多行业内优秀的开发者和专家,提供了丰富的技术文章、教程和问题解答。对于西工大软件学院的申请者来说,CSDN可以作为一个宝贵的学习资源,可以通过阅读和参与讨论来加深对各种软件开发知识和实践的理解。
此外,CSDN还提供了求职招聘的信息,对于毕业生来说,可以在CSDN上找到各种与软件开发相关的工作机会。可以说,CSDN对于软件学院的申请者来说具有重要的参考价值,不仅可以提供学习资源,同时也可以对就业情况有所了解和提前做好就业准备。
总而言之,西工大软件学院的复试真题主要考察申请者的软件开发能力,而CSDN则提供了广泛的学习资源和求职信息,对于申请者来说具有重要的参考价值。通过合理利用CSDN这个资源,申请者可以更好地准备复试,提高自己在软件学院中的竞争力。
相关问题
四川大学计算机学院复试 csdn
### 回答1:
四川大学计算机学院对于申请者进行复试时,往往会与CSDN(中国最大的IT社区和编程技术资源分享平台)进行合作。
在复试阶段,申请者可能会面临多个环节的考核,如面试、笔试、项目展示等。针对计算机学院的申请者,CSDN作为一个知名的IT社区,在复试环节中提供重要的支持。首先,CSDN会邀请一些计算机专业的顶尖专家来担任面试官,他们具有丰富的行业经验和知识背景,能够全面评估申请者的学术能力和潜力。
其次,CSDN可以提供题库和试卷设计方面的支持。他们可以为复试候选人准备一些常见的计算机问题,并根据计算机学院的教学要求进行针对性地设置。这样能够更好地评估申请者的专业水平和解决问题的能力。
此外,CSDN还可以为申请者提供项目展示平台。申请者可以在平台上展示他们的计算机相关项目,如软件开发、算法设计等。这不仅有助于申请者展示自己的实际操作能力,还可以让面试官更清楚地了解他们的潜力和创新能力。
总之,四川大学计算机学院与CSDN的合作,为学院复试过程提供了更全面和专业的评估方式。借助CSDN的资源和平台,学院可以更好地选拔出适合计算机学习的优秀申请者,为学院的教育质量和人才培养提供有力的支持。
### 回答2:
四川大学计算机学院是一个具有优秀教学和研究水平的学院,其复试环节对于申请者来说极为重要。
首先,复试的目的是为了进一步了解申请者的学术水平和综合素质。一般来说,复试分为笔试和面试两个环节。其中,笔试部分主要考察申请者在计算机相关学科方面的知识,如数据结构、算法、操作系统等。面试部分则更注重申请者的个人表现和潜力,通过与考官的交流,考察申请者的学术研究兴趣、动机以及解决问题的能力。
其次,在准备复试时,申请者可以通过参加各种培训班、做相关考试题目和刷题网站的题目来提升自己的知识水平。此外,平时还可以阅读学术论文,了解最新的研究动态,增强自己的学术基础。
最后,在复试中,申请者要展现出自己的专业知识和学术热情。在面试环节中,申请者要自信地回答问题,表达自己的见解和想法。同时,要积极与考官进行互动,展示自己的学术兴趣和思考方式。此外,申请者还要展示自己具备解决问题的能力和团队合作的精神,因为计算机学科是一个注重实践和合作的学科。
总之,四川大学计算机学院的复试是一个高度重视学术能力和综合素质的过程。申请者需要充分准备,展示出自己的专业知识和学术热情,以获得录取的机会。
在西北工业大学软件工程考研复试中,如何利用Java实现一个高效的排序算法来解决编程题?请结合《西工大软件工程考研复试Java机试题解析》提供一个具体算法实现的示例。
在准备西北工业大学软件工程考研复试的过程中,掌握高效的排序算法对于解决编程题目至关重要。为了深入理解这一问题,建议查阅《西工大软件工程考研复试Java机试题解析》这本书,它将为你提供实战场景下的具体算法实现和解题策略。
参考资源链接:[西工大软件工程考研复试Java机试题解析](https://wenku.csdn.net/doc/6mxag5z7zc?spm=1055.2569.3001.10343)
一个经典的高效排序算法是快速排序(Quick Sort),它通常比其他简单的排序算法如冒泡排序和插入排序要快。快速排序的基本思想是选择一个基准元素(pivot),然后将数组分为两个子数组,一个包含所有小于基准元素的值,另一个包含所有大于基准元素的值,然后递归地对这两个子数组进行快速排序。
以下是快速排序算法在Java中的实现示例:
```java
public class QuickSort {
public static void quickSort(int[] arr, int low, int high) {
if (low < high) {
// 找到基准元素的正确位置
int pivotIndex = partition(arr, low, high);
// 递归地对基准元素左右两侧的子数组进行快速排序
quickSort(arr, low, pivotIndex - 1);
quickSort(arr, pivotIndex + 1, high);
}
}
private static int partition(int[] arr, int low, int high) {
int pivot = arr[high];
int i = (low - 1);
for (int j = low; j < high; j++) {
// 当前元素小于或等于基准
if (arr[j] <= pivot) {
i++;
// 交换 arr[i] 和 arr[j]
int temp = arr[i];
arr[i] = arr[j];
arr[j] = temp;
}
}
// 将基准元素放到正确的位置
int temp = arr[i + 1];
arr[i + 1] = arr[high];
arr[high] = temp;
return i + 1;
}
public static void main(String[] args) {
int[] arr = {10, 7, 8, 9, 1, 5};
int n = arr.length;
quickSort(arr, 0, n - 1);
System.out.println(
参考资源链接:[西工大软件工程考研复试Java机试题解析](https://wenku.csdn.net/doc/6mxag5z7zc?spm=1055.2569.3001.10343)
阅读全文
相关推荐












